Pomellato Senior Manager of Accounting, Consolidation, and Reporting
DoDo, a distinguished brand under the Kering Group umbrella, is renowned for its innovative approach to luxury jewelry, offering unique "talking charms" that blend playful storytelling with profound emotional significance. As a leader in sustainability, DoDo is committed to using 100% responsible gold in its creations, reflecting its dedication to inclusivity, self-expression, and environmental stewardship. As part of the Kering Group, DoDo benefits from the resources and prestige of a global luxury conglomerate, providing employees with unparalleled opportunities for growth and development.
- Lead, mentor, and develop a team of accounting professionals, fostering a culture of accountability, collaboration, and continuous improvement.
- Serve as the main contact for auditors, advisors, and key internal stakeholders.
- Oversee monthly and year-end closing, ensuring accurate consolidated financial statements.
- Ensure compliance with applicable accounting standards (IFRS / US GAAP / local GAAP).
- Supervise core administrative and accounting activities, including invoicing, intercompany reconciliations, journals, accruals, payroll entries, and fixed asset accounting.
- Prepare statutory financial statements under OIC and support statutory and internal audit requirements.
- Prepare and analyze the balance sheet, ensuring accuracy, completeness, and adherence to internal policies.
- Manage monthly tax accruals for Group Reporting and submit them for fiscal consolidation.
- Coordinate the annual budget and periodic forecast processes across all departments.
- Develop and maintain Free Cash Flow forecasts, analyzing variances and providing insights for decision-making.
- Produce timely and reliable financial reports, ensuring compliance with internal controls and regulatory requirements.
- Partner with finance leadership to implement automation, digital tools, and best practices.
- Play a key role in financial system upgrades or ERP implementation projects.
